WebThis means that it becomes necessary to override the automatic 50:50 income split mentioned above. To do this requires that Form 17 (‘Declaration of beneficial interests in joint property income’) be filed with HMRC. Form 17 allows a married couple to determine how the rental income is to be split; however, any split of such income must be ... WebIncome tax Act 2007 s 836 provides that husbands and wives or civil partners living together are generally treated as entitled in equal shares to income from jointly held property. ... Form 17 declarations need to reach HMRC within 60 days of the date it was signed. HMRC may request further evidence on the beneficial interest that the party ...
